CAMERA SETUP
Depending on your system’s current configuration, up to 32 video cameras can be connected to a single DX8100. The following section illustrates
basic camera configuration. You must be logged in as an Administrator or Power User to configure cameras.

BASIC CAMERA SETUP
To set up camera picture and PTZ options:
1. Do one of the following:
On the DX8100 toolbar, click . The Setup dialog opens to the Camera page.
If the Setup dialog box is already open, click . The Camera page is displayed.
2. In the Camera Properties section, do the following:
a. Select a camera from the drop-down box. (You can also select a camera from the Site tree by clicking on it.)
b. Select the Disable check box if you want to disable the camera.
c. Enter an optional new name for the camera. Camera names can be up to 32 characters long and can include spaces and special
characters.
d. Set camera security level. The default security levels are as follows:
None: The camera can be viewed by all users.
Low: The camera can be viewed by all users including the Guest account.
NOTE: If you do not want video from a low security level camera to be viewed by the Guest user, set the security level for that
cameras to medium or higher.
Medium: The camera can be viewed by users with Standard User access and higher.
High: The camera can be viewed by users with Power User access and higher.
e. In the Protocol drop-down box, select the appropriate PTZ protocol for the camera, or select No PTZ if the selected camera does not
support PTZ functions. Some of the supported protocol options are as follows:
NO PTZ: Disables all PTZ functions for the current camera
PELCO-C: Coaxitron
PELCO-D: Pelco engineered
PELCO-P: Pelco engineered
